Find us on LinkedIn too 👉
Scale Down Logo
Doneverse logo

Digital Marketing Team Leader

Doneverse
Full-time
Remote
Philippines
Manager

Digital Marketing Team Leader

Full-Time | Remote (Philippines-based)


About Us

Doneverse (formerly Outsourced Doers) is a rapidly growing global company that connects entrepreneurs and business owners with highly trained Digital Marketing Virtual Assistants who help them scale faster and work smarter. We are expanding our Digital Marketing Team and looking for a strong, performance-driven Team Leader who knows how to inspire output, develop talent, and drive results.


Role Overview

The Digital Marketing Team Leader is responsible for managing, mentoring, and driving the performance of a team of digital marketers. The ideal candidate is highly organized, metrics-driven, and skilled in either website/funnel building or social media management. This role involves overseeing task execution, ensuring quality output, optimizing workflows, and supporting team growth while maintaining high client delivery standards.


Key Responsibilities

Team Leadership & Performance Management

  • Lead and manage a team of Digital Marketing Specialists, ensuring performance targets and KPIs are consistently met.

  • Conduct regular performance reviews, coaching, and skills development sessions.

  • Monitor daily outputs, timelines, and productivity to ensure high-quality execution.

  • Identify performance gaps and implement corrective action plans when needed.

  • Foster a results-driven team culture with accountability, ownership, and continuous improvement.

Digital Marketing Oversight

  • Oversee and review digital marketing deliverables to ensure alignment with brand, strategy, and client expectations.

  • Provide expert guidance in either:

    • Website/Funnel Building (WordPress, ClickFunnels, Kajabi, GoHighLevel, or similar), or

    • Social Media Strategy & Management (content planning, analytics, optimization).

  • Support the team with troubleshooting, creative direction, and technical problem-solving.

Workflow & Project Management

  • Assign and manage workload across the team to balance capacity and deadlines.

  • Improve and optimize internal processes, SOPs, and quality checkpoints.

  • Liaise with cross-functional teams (copywriting, design, accounts) to ensure seamless execution.

  • Track work progress through project management tools (e.g., Asana, ClickUp, Trello).

Client & Stakeholder Alignment

  • Ensure timely and accurate delivery of client requests.

  • Act as an escalation point for client concerns or technical challenges.

  • Collaborate with leadership to update strategies, refine workflows, and enhance client experience.


Qualifications

  • Minimum 3+ years of experience in digital marketing.

  • At least 1–2 years of leadership or supervisory experience in a digital or creative team.

  • Strong working knowledge of either:

    • Website/Funnel building (WordPress, ClickFunnels, Leadpages, Kajabi, GoHighLevel, etc.)
      OR

    • Social media strategy, execution, and analytics.

  • Demonstrated ability to drive performance and manage a team in a fast-paced environment.

  • Strong understanding of digital marketing fundamentals: branding, content, SEO basics, funnels, paid ads basics (a plus but not required).

  • Excellent communication, coaching, and conflict-resolution skills.

  • Highly organized, detail-oriented, and confident in managing deadlines.

  • Ability to thrive under pressure while maintaining a positive, solution-oriented attitude.


Why Join Us?

  • 100% permanent work-from-home setup

  • Work with a high-performing, supportive team

  • Opportunity to lead a growing digital marketing department

  • Career advancement, training, and professional development

  • Competitive compensation package

Apply now
Share this job